Home Health Aide (HHA) Duties and Responsibilities:
• Preparation of meals in accordance with modified diets or complex diets.
• Administration of medications.
• Provision of special skin care.
• Use of medical equipment, supplies and devices.
• Change of dressing to stable surface wounds.
• Performance of maintenance exercise program.
• Care of an achieve after the clients has achieved its normal function.
Home Health Aide Requirements:
-Has successfully completed a training and competency evaluation program or a competency program conducted by an approved home health aide training program.
- Excellent communication skills (written and oral) Easy to learn with plenty of experiences in HHA field
-Ability to demonstrate compassion and patience in tending to patient needs. Must have moderate physica-l strength. Must have a valid Driver’s License with reliable transportation.
